Output f91ef3050336a2efc2e95a108d96b257d7e7dfa03a27d7fa0dc809d808345695:1

value
65860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b0c68a84758eb5ec23e68aa8419faf9eaf4c8552 OP_EQUAL
address
3HoihBXK7s3xTjRznwLGQ7XyeV89aBh2dP
transaction
f91ef3050336a2efc2e95a108d96b257d7e7dfa03a27d7fa0dc809d808345695
confirmations
119433
spent
true